I need to create QSO lists selecting one by one and then export to an ADIF file.
I know how to make filtered lists, but I haven't been able to find a way to select one by one.
It is about making an ADIF list to print the QSLs received from the bureau.

In general, in Windows lists, you can use the Ctrl key to multiple select. Specifically, if you click on row in your recent QSO list, it is selected. If you click on a different row, the first is deselected and the new row selected but, if instead, you hold down the Ctrl key and then click new rows, all rows clicked on will remain selected.

After selecting the rows, do the right click and select "Export selected to ADIF"
